Aerial view of construction at Dock Street and 3rd Street, with the First Bank of United States prominent near the center of the frame. Behind that is Carpenters Hall, then the Second Bank of the United States, and finally Independence Hall.

This file comes from the Historic American Buildings Survey (HABS), Historic American Engineering Record (HAER) or Historic American Landscapes Survey (HALS). These are programs of the National Park Service established for the purpose of documenting historic places. Records consist of measured drawings, archival photographs, and written reports.
